China's Pension Reform: Policy Research and Response to Challenge of Aging Population

By (author) Tao Wang, By (author) Ke Gao, By (author) Ennan Zhao

This book aims to present an overview of China’s pension reform by first comprehensively analyzing the population aging situation, including its characteristics and future trends predicted through various models. It then examines the current state of the pension system, from its composition and reform history to the details of the endowment insurance fund. It further explores the reasons for reform, considering both external pressures and internal parameter limitations. Moreover, it looks into future reform directions by studying international experiences and China’s unique circumstances, and also analyzes the potential impacts and prospects, including aspects like international cooperation and the role of technological development. The content spans a wide range. It covers demographic aspects related to population aging, the structure and operation of the pension system, the economic and financial aspects such as fund management and sustainability, policy-related elements like reform causes and directions, international comparisons and cooperation, and the intersection of technology and pensions, including how digitalization, big data, artificial intelligence, and blockchain are changing the pension landscape.
